My Story 

Liza Balkan is a Canadian Dora Award-winning, multi-disciplinary theatre artist, with a professional career that spans over forty years. She is a director, artist/educator, writer, librettist, dramaturge and actor - each practice intersecting and informing the other. Liza began studying as a dancer at the age of 6. At 18 she moved her primary focus on to acting, studying in both Toronto and New York City, where she graduated from the American Academy of Dramatic Arts. She has had decades of a freelance acting career both in Canada and the US. In 2001, Liza began adding directing, writing, and teaching to her theatre practices. Her freelance directing experience embraces theatre and opera, the development and creation of new work, site-specific projects, musical theatre, classical and contemporary text, and productions with young artists and students at the university level. Her works as a writer and librettist have been produced in theatres, Festivals and major concert halls in Canada and the US.  Her documentary project Out the Window, was produced by the International Luminato Festival in Toronto, and has been published by Scirocco Drama. She received her MFA in 2019 throug the CanadianStage /York Graduate Studies in Directing Program.  Liza is devoted to her extensive practice as an educator. She is presently on faculty at Sharjah Performing Arts Academy in the UAE.
